Output 211d28c4a8ab90fa92b9597bd6a3788bf1f244b3391725f8cd8e2ac0d30d468a:103

value
32700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8efc52f1f4ac66aa8eacb9b71b11436f4a46cfbf OP_EQUAL
address
3Ej49ZbhWW6NXQ4pqgTdx1jue8XCVzjBmU
transaction
211d28c4a8ab90fa92b9597bd6a3788bf1f244b3391725f8cd8e2ac0d30d468a
spent
true